M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a mitochondrion outer membrane protein that catalyzes the hydroxylation of L-tryptophan metabolite, L-kynurenine, to form L-3-hydroxykynurenine. Studies in yeast identified this gene as a therapeutic target for Huntington disease. [provided by RefSeq, Oct 2011]
PHENOTYPE: Mice homozygous for a knock-out allele lack kynurenine 3-monooxygenase activity and altered levels of several tryptophan metabolites. Mice homozygous for another null allele exhibit increased LPS-induced depressive behaviors and altered kynurenine metabolism. [provided by MGI curators]
